/*
 * DNS_RETRY_BACKOFF_MS controls retry spacing when Fernwhistle's resolver
 * intermittently fails to answer for the upstream billing host. Support team:
 * if customers report sporadic "host unreachable" errors that clear on their
 * own, this flakiness is the usual culprit — it is NOT a customer network
 * issue. Escalate only if failures persist past three retries. When filing,
 * quote the build token printed just below this comment.
 */

session token of kahif-kageg = htk14_01cd78718aea51

## Changelog — Tidemark Widget 3.2

Defaults changed. Read before touching anything.

- Refresh interval now hourly, not every 15 min. Harbor feeds from the Pellisport aggregator throttle aggressive polling.
- Lunar-offset correction is on by default. Disable only for legacy Kestrel Bay deployments.
- Chart units default to metric. The imperial fallback flag is deprecated and will be removed in 3.4.
- Cache eviction is now time-based, not size-based.

New installs should start from the default configuration values listed below.

config for kahap-taweg:
oliox:
  pin: 8609
  tenant: casath
  seal: seal_632a4a6f
  metrics_host: metrics.oliox.nelvrogrid.example
  standby_team: keleth
  escalation: briiel-oliwyn
  nonce: e2397c

Facilities ticket — Halewick Tower, night shift.

Issue: support team reporting east stairwell reader rejecting badges after midnight. Reader was reset this morning; firmware updated. Overnight crew should now badge as normal. If the reader fails again, use the manual keypad by the fire door — do not prop the door. Log any further failures with the time and badge name. Temporary keypad code for the fallback door is below.

door code, tajeg-fawip: bdg-K-62

Subject: Winding down the Tilbrook Lane office

Hi all,

As flagged at last week's huddle, we're going ahead with closing the Tilbrook Lane site by end of quarter. It's a small team — six people — and everyone is being offered a move to the Ashmere hub or remote arrangements. Facilities will handle the kit and the sublease paperwork. Please keep this quiet until the team has been told individually. The confidential rationale and next steps are set out just below.

Thanks,
Piet

management briefing: Jorixax Holdings is in early talks to buy Casixax Holdings for about $420.3 million. The Fenmir launch date is October 27, and nothing goes to the press before then. Legal wants the Keloxek Foods term sheet redrafted before April 16.